Output Gain Reduction Meters

Each output channel has a four-segment gain reduction meter that shows the effect of the output channel Limiter on output level; from 0dBu to -12dBu. Output limiting can be bypassed by entering Edit mode, selecting Output Channel Limiter and selecting a limiter threshold of +21 dBu (8.205V) or turning the Bypass parameter to “On”.

Output Channel Mute Buttons

Each output channel has a lighted Mute button. Pressing the Mute button turns off the output of that channel. The button lights red as an alert. Press the Mute button again to restore the output channel’s signal.

Output Channel Function Indicators

Each output channel has a four-segment function display for informational purposes only. For any given configuration possible with the DC-One, an output channel may be identified as a sub, low, low/mid, mid, mid/hi, hi or full range output. One or two adjacent LED’s are displayed to indicate all possible output bandpasses. (Full range is indicated by no lit LED’s.)

Preset Recall

The DC-One preset memory

provides 60 factory program presets Recall and can store up to 20 user presets.

(F01-F60, U01 – U20) Factory presets have been designed to represent common system configurations utilizing Electro-Voice

loudspeaker systems. User presets allow you to accommodate other system configurations and / or loudspeaker systems.

To recall a preset, press the front panel Recall button. The display switches to the Recall Preset screen and displays the next in a list of available presets in memory. Using the Value Up and Down buttons, select the preset to be recalled. Valid presets will display the preset name. Empty presets will display a “?”.

Select a valid preset and press Recall again. The display will prompt, “Recall Preset? Press Recall”. Press Recall a third time to confirm and load the new preset.

If the preset you are recalling is based on a configuration different from that of the current preset, the display will prompt, “Changing config can damage speakers”, to remind you that the new preset may not be appropriate for your system as it is currently connected. Press Recall again to confirm and load the new preset.
